July 16 - fav plant of the day - Shasta Daisy. I know a lot of people love these cheerful girls! They are easy-care and LOVE the SUN!
July 17 - Coneflower. OK - I do realize this one is completely covered by a lovely butterfly, but what can I do? Butterflies love them, and I couldn't just brush her away, could I?
July 18 - Fav plant of the day - this is a hydrangea hardy enough for our Zone 5 climate. Doesn't get as humungeous as the hydrangeas I remember in Oregon, but a nice plant for shady areas. Her dark stems are especially attractive.
